Shoaib urges Misbah to start ‘rebuilding’ after flop show against Sri Lanka

After a 3-0 series whitewash at the hands of Sri Lanka, it is high time for Pakistan head coach and chief selector Misbah-ul-Haq to start 'rebuilding', says former fast bowler Shoaib Akhtar.

“It is so disheartening to see Pakistan lose like this. If I were Misbah, I would pick up the pieces from here and rebuild. Have to make a combination of new and experienced. A combination that works,” the speedster tweeted. “I hope we do a solid rebuilding from here,” he added.

The statement comes after the top ranked Pakistan suffered a 3-0 defeat in T20I series against the eighth ranked Sri Lanka on Wednesday at Lahore Gaddafi Stadium.

Earlier, skipper Sarfaraz Ahmed admitted that the team needs to improve in all aspects of the game. “We need to improve in all facets. If we keep dropping catches like this in the middle overs, we won't be able to beat any team,” he said.

Sri Lanka, despite playing with a relatively young side, outclassed the hosts and managed to achieve the clean sweep for the first time against Pakistan.
